Abstract [eng] Purpose of work is to define the main factors influencing subjective well being and indexes of SC “Lietkabelis” employees’ satisfaction. There are theoretical and empirical parts. At theoretical part there are defined main theories of subjective well being and it’s forming factors. The object and methods. During the research there were 100 inquired employees of SC “Lietkabelis” and two questionnaires used: Minnesota satisfaction questionnaire and Positive and Negative Affect Scales. As the data of the research shows employees satisfaction is low (2.67). The biggest satisfaction which meets employees expectations is intercourse with core workers, job position doesn’t contradict with moral values, conviction that job done contributes to social wellness, usability of skills at work. The least confident employees feel about payment for the job done, companies politics and practices, future safety of the company and working place. Research also showed that the bigger employee’s satisfaction with work concerns bigger index of positive and negative emotional scale.
